Over the past decade, the dominant paradigm of digital content has shifted from desktop-centric to mobile-centric. According to Statista, by 2024, over 78% of global web traffic is projected to originate from mobile devices, emphasizing the critical need for publishers to optimize for this platform (Source: Statista, 2023). This shift compels content creators and distributors to rethink their strategy—from layout and user interface to interactive features and monetization models.
Traditional publishing models, anchored in web-based platforms and print legacy, now face the challenge of integrating interactive multimedia, personalized content streams, and real-time engagement. Notably, mobile-friendly apps have emerged as the central hub for such innovation, allowing a more immersive experience beyond the constraints of browsers.
